Condo association reserve gone and board refuses owners questions

I live in a 100 unit condo in Illinois. Our condo is 15 years old. We have less than one year of board minutes, and financial records. We show reserves from only a few months ago. There have been no capitol expenditures for at least ten years, but the board refuses to say what happened to the reserves from those years. Most concerning, there was a very large special assessment three years ago, that the board said was a mistake, and not needed. They said they would use it to build up the reserve. These funds have disappeared. The board refuses to answer any questions or give any account about the missing reserves. We are not sure what we should do now.
